2024年2月19日发(作者:)

burp的使用方法

Burp Suite是一款常用的Web应用程序渗透测试工具,它能够帮助测试人员发现并利用Web应用程序中存在的漏洞。本文将介绍Burp Suite的使用方法,帮助读者了解如何使用这个强大的工具进行渗透测试。

一、Burp Suite的安装与配置

我们需要从官方网站下载Burp Suite的安装包,并按照提示进行安装。安装完成后,打开Burp Suite并进行一些基本的配置。

1. 配置代理服务器

Burp Suite通过拦截和修改HTTP/HTTPS请求来进行渗透测试,因此我们需要将浏览器的代理设置指向Burp Suite。在Burp Suite的Proxy选项卡中,可以找到相应的监听端口号,将浏览器的代理服务器地址和端口号设置为该值即可。

2. 安装SSL证书

为了能够拦截和修改HTTPS请求,Burp Suite需要安装自己的SSL证书。在Burp Suite的Proxy选项卡中,找到"CA

Certificate"并点击"Install / Export CA Certificate"按钮,然后按照提示安装证书到浏览器中。

二、使用Burp Suite进行渗透测试

安装和配置完成后,我们可以开始使用Burp Suite进行渗透测试了。

下面将介绍一些常用的功能和操作。

1. 拦截和修改请求

在Proxy选项卡中,我们可以点击"Intercept is on"按钮来拦截请求。当请求被拦截时,我们可以查看和修改请求的内容,然后决定是否将请求发送到服务器。

2. 扫描目标

在Target选项卡中,我们可以输入目标URL并点击"Add to

Scope"按钮来添加目标。然后,可以点击"Spider"按钮来进行网站爬取,或者点击"Scanner"按钮来进行漏洞扫描。

3. 发现漏洞

Burp Suite提供了一些常见漏洞的检测插件,比如SQL注入、XSS等。在Scanner选项卡中,我们可以选择相应的插件并运行进行扫描。扫描完成后,可以在"Scanner"选项卡中查看扫描结果。

4. 报告生成

在完成渗透测试后,我们可以生成报告以记录测试结果。在Burp

Suite的Report选项卡中,可以选择相应的报告模板,并设置报告的输出格式和目标路径。

5. 其他功能

除了上述功能外,Burp Suite还提供了许多其他有用的功能,比如

分析请求和响应、进行参数化和重放等。用户可以根据具体需要进行使用。

三、注意事项与技巧

在使用Burp Suite进行渗透测试时,还需要注意一些常见的问题和技巧。

1. 避免对生产环境造成影响

在进行渗透测试时,一定要注意对目标系统的影响。尽量避免在生产环境中进行测试,以免对正常业务造成影响。

2. 使用插件和脚本增强功能

Burp Suite支持插件和脚本扩展,用户可以根据需要安装和使用相应的插件和脚本,以增强工具的功能和效果。

3. 学习和了解Web安全知识

Burp Suite是一款强大的工具,但它只是帮助我们发现和利用漏洞的工具。对于渗透测试人员而言,了解和掌握常见的Web安全漏洞和攻击技术是必不可少的。

4. 学习和掌握Burp Suite的高级功能

除了基本的功能和操作外,Burp Suite还提供了许多高级功能和技巧,比如使用Intruder进行暴力破解、使用Repeater进行请求重放等。学习和掌握这些高级功能可以帮助我们更好地进行渗透测试。

总结:

在本文中,我们介绍了Burp Suite的安装与配置方法,并详细介绍了其常用的功能和操作。通过学习和使用Burp Suite,我们可以更好地进行Web应用程序的渗透测试,发现并利用其中存在的漏洞。当然,在使用Burp Suite进行渗透测试时,我们还需要具备一定的Web安全知识和技能,以确保测试的准确性和有效性。希望读者能够通过本文的介绍和学习,对Burp Suite有更深入的了解和掌握。